A common question we receive: are split level homes more expensive to build. On average, sloping blocks are cheaper than standard flat blocks. This comes down to demand for level building sites and the ease of building on a level surface.
While there might be a little more work involved with a sloping site (e.g. excavation and additional piering), the reduced cost of the land means you’ll have more money to spend on all the items on your home design wishlist!
